A third elephant at Dublin Zoo has now contracted a virus that killed two other members of the herd this month.

Image: Dublin Zoo He said Dublin Zoo is taking part in global research into EEHV and is backing efforts to develop a vaccine against it.

The other two females, nine-year-old Samiya and 40-year-old Dina, are showing no signs of the virus; however, he warned that “because this is a fluid situation and we have seen a very quick deterioration in the two that unfortunately passed away over the last week, we cannot say how this will develop”.
